Vago wrote:Thats what I said. Bungie ended the series. They shouldn't be making another one. If its made by Bungie I might let it slide, but if its not then this may be the dumbest decision ever.
LordRemington wrote:Indeed, I knew Bungie said Halo:Reach was it for them. I am still curious as to see what a new Halo would be like, especially if they were planning on bringing back the Master Chief
Halo 4 is being developed by 343 Industries, which I think partly consists of people who've been working on Halo previously over the years. So Halo Reach was Bungie's last Halo game, but not the last Halo ever. I'm not sure what to expect from this new game though. It's the beginning of a new trilogy, which we will hopefully have fun with during coming years. I really wonder what's left for Master Chief to shoot, with the Flood and the Covenant defeated.
